Assessing the Missile Strike Threat

According to Espreso.tv: Aviation expert Bohdan Dolintse has warned that the Russian military is preparing for another major missile attack, with preparations typically taking between one and one-and-a-half weeks. According to Dolintse, this timeline suggests an attack could occur very soon. The warning comes after a Russian missile strike early Sunday, May 24, on Kyiv, which left 81 people wounded and two dead. Dolintse also noted that Bastion missile systems, previously redeployed to the northern border between Russia and Ukraine, have not been withdrawn—a sign, he says, of Moscow's readiness for further aggression.
